X-Git-Url: https://git.creatis.insa-lyon.fr/pubgit/?a=blobdiff_plain;ds=sidebyside;f=packages%2Fwx%2Fsrc%2FbbwxSlider.cxx;h=7039139bfb0be22fedd0688e1708f4ae6b35a071;hb=555854b9edeeb49fdd03fad2b1274e6d6db6d9f7;hp=557e7b2a7459bfde9625f5d45f8898576339f76d;hpb=a26195c366a89795288009cf7e20f11afa494970;p=bbtk.git diff --git a/packages/wx/src/bbwxSlider.cxx b/packages/wx/src/bbwxSlider.cxx index 557e7b2..7039139 100644 --- a/packages/wx/src/bbwxSlider.cxx +++ b/packages/wx/src/bbwxSlider.cxx @@ -3,8 +3,8 @@ Program: bbtk Module: $RCSfile: bbwxSlider.cxx,v $ Language: C++ - Date: $Date: 2008/01/22 15:02:00 $ - Version: $Revision: 1.1 $ + Date: $Date: 2008/01/22 15:41:35 $ + Version: $Revision: 1.2 $ Copyright (c) CREATIS (Centre de Recherche et d'Applications en Traitement de l'Image). All rights reserved. See Doc/License.txt or @@ -354,25 +354,25 @@ namespace bbwx //-------------------------------------------------------------------------- void Slider::Process() { - int val = bbGetInputIn(); bbSetOutputOut( bbGetInputIn() ); + } - if (bbGetOutputWidget()==0) - { - bbSetOutputWidget( new SliderWidget(this, - bbGetWxParent(), - bbGetInputOrientation() , - bbGetInputChangeResolution(), - bbGetInputLabel(), - bbtk::std2wx( bbGetInputTitle() ), - bbGetInputMin(), - bbGetInputMax(), - val, - bbGetInputReactiveOnTrack() - ) - ); - } + void Slider::CreateWidget() + { + bbSetOutputWidget( new SliderWidget(this, + bbGetWxParent(), + bbGetInputOrientation() , + bbGetInputChangeResolution(), + bbGetInputLabel(), + bbtk::std2wx( bbGetInputTitle() ), + bbGetInputMin(), + bbGetInputMax(), + bbGetInputIn(), + bbGetInputReactiveOnTrack() + ) + ); } + //-------------------------------------------------------------------------- /* //--------------------------------------------------------------------------